United have sacked Mourinho.
https://www.theguardian.com/football...d-sack-managerManchester United have sacked José Mourinho following Sunday’s defeat at Liverpool, ending a tenure that began in May 2016.A poor start to the Premier League season has seen United slip 19 points behind the leaders, Liverpool, and fall off the pace in the hunt for a top-four place. They have won only once in six league matches, drawing during that sequence with struggling Southampton and Crystal Palace.
